Well Collapse in Jharkhand: 2 Bodies Found, 3 Still Trapped; NDRF Continues Rescue Operation

An official said on Friday that two corpses had been retrieved from a well in a hamlet in the Ranchi district of Jharkhand after part of it fell in. According to Hemant Soren, chief minister of Jharkhand, five persons perished on Thursday in the Piska hamlet when a piece of a well fell in.

The death toll is yet unclear, according to NDRF authorities, since the search and rescue effort is still ongoing.

The tragedy happened in the hamlet of Piska, which is around 70 miles from Ranchi, the state capital.

The awful news of five persons dying in a well in the hamlet of Piska hurts my heart. Soren said on X (previously Twitter): “May God provide the departed spirits peace, and give strength to the mourning family members to face this tough hour of loss.

The number of fatalities is yet unknown, according to members of the National Disaster Response Force (NDRF), but attempts are being made to free individuals who are stuck within the well.

After an animal fell into the well, the occurrence took place in the afternoon. Nine people entered the well to try to save it, but part of it collapsed in, according to Ranchi SP (Rural) H B Jama.

Two corpses have so far been found, an NDRF officer informed PTI. The villagers found one corpse on Thursday, and we found another one while working here. The effort to rescue the other three stranded individuals is now under process. He said that in addition to recovering the ox’s corpse, which had fallen into the well, was also found.

“Boulders were used in the well’s construction. The removal of the stones is proving to be quite challenging. So, at this time, we are unable to estimate how long the rescue effort will go.
